Understanding Different Types of EV Chargers

There are primarily three types of EV chargers – Level 1, Level 2, and DC Fast Chargers. Each type offers different charging speeds and comes with its own set of requirements.

Level 1 chargers are the most basic, using a standard 120-volt AC plug. While they don’t require any special installation, they offer slow charging speeds, typically providing about 4-5 miles of range per hour of charging.

Level 2 chargers use a 240-volt AC plug and can deliver about 10-60 miles of range per hour of charging. They are the most common type of charger for business installations, offering a good balance between cost and charging speed. DC Fast Chargers provide the quickest charging speeds, delivering 60-100 miles of range in just 20 minutes of charging. However, they are significantly more expensive and require a high-power direct current (DC) connection.

Assessing Your Business Needs

When choosing an EV charger for your business, it’s essential to assess your specific needs. Here are some factors to consider:

  1. Type of Vehicles: The types of EVs you’ll be charging can influence your choice of charger. Some vehicles may not be compatible with certain types of chargers or may not be able to take advantage of the faster charging speeds offered by higher-level chargers.

  2. Charging Speed: If the chargers will be used primarily by employees who will be at work for several hours, a Level 2 charger may be sufficient. However, if you’re looking to provide charging for customers or need to charge vehicles quickly during the day, a DC Fast Charger may be more appropriate.

  3. Budget: Your budget will also play a significant role in your choice of charger. While Level 2 chargers may be more affordable upfront, the faster charging speeds of DC Fast Chargers could provide more value in the long run, depending on your needs.

  4. Available Space: The available space at your premises can also influence your choice. Some chargers may require more space or specific installation conditions.

  5. Government Incentives: Various government incentives can help offset the cost of installing EV chargers. Be sure to research available incentives in your area, as this could influence your decision.
